- Well, it wasn’t the “Red State” casting news we expected, but we should have figured this out — On yesterday’s XM-broadcast Opie & Anthony show, Kevin announced that SModcast will be coming to the Sirius/XM family via a mix of classic rebroadcasts as well as new material. The new material will come by the way of a monthly edition, which can only be heard on satellite. They’ll also broadcast uncut episodes from the SModcast network, allowing subscribers of XM or the Best of XM package of Sirius on-the-run access on The Virus, channel 202 XM / 197 Sirius/XM.
THIS SATURDAY, at 1:00 PM ET, Kevin and Scott will debut a brand new, never-before heard episode. Then, enjoy a SModcast marathon starting on SUNDAY from 7:00 AM until midnight ET on the same channels. Yes, that’s 17 straight hours of uncut SModcast! New and classic episodes of SMod will air at 1:00 PM ET each week, with other broadcast times set to be announced.

- Sirius XM (SIRI) Radio To Launch New Show Hosted By Director Kevin Smith
Director, actor, writer, and producer Kevin Smith is coming to Sirius XM Radio (NASDAQ:SIRI). The Satellite Radio provider announced today that they will bring Kevin Smith’s popular, weekly SModcast program to it’s subscribers. Smith will also be launching a brand-new and exclusive monthly edition, created with the help of his longtime producer and cohost Scott Mosier, beginning this Saturday, September 25th, 2010.
“I’m ecstatic to be a part of the SIRIUS XM family and hope folks find our SModcast program as funny as we do. I loved when The Virus promoted SModcast, back when we first launched the show because, every now and then, I’d be driving around listening to XM and catch SModcast on satellite radio.” – Kevin Smith
Smith broke the news this morning on Sirius XM’s Opie & Anthony program, where he has been a frequent guest. Opie & Anthony’s contract with Sirius XM expires in less than two weeks, with no word yet of any resolution.
According to Sirius XM, Kevin Smith’s weekly show will be “an uncensored, unscripted and unpredictable program on which he shares observations/musings on any topic on his mind: politics, sex, comic books, food, technology, religion, and beyond.”
“I have been a fan of Kevin Smith’s sharp wit, keen eye, creativity and independent spirit for many years. Sirius XM is thrilled to bring his unfiltered voice and perspective of the world to millions of listeners across the country.” – Scott Greenstein, President and Chief Content Officer, Sirius XM Radio
Smith’s debut film Clerks was a cult favorite, bringing Smith critical acclaim and a cult following. Smiths other popular feature films include Chasing Amy, Dogma, Jay and Silent Bob Strike Back, Mallrats, and Zack and Miri Make a Porno. Smith’s next project will be the “political horror film” Red State, slated for a 2011 release. Smith also recently published a comic book version of The Green Hornet.
Smith’s SModcast program launches on Sirius XM’s The Virus, XM channel 202 and Sirius channel 197 as part of the “Best of XM” package, this Saturday, September 25 at 1:00 pm ET, with an original, never before heard episode. SModcast will continue to air weekly during that timeslot. To celebrate the launch of Smith’s SModcast on Sirius XM, a SModcast marathon, featuring a replay of the new show as well as episodes from Smith’s SModcast archives, will air on Sunday, September 26th from 7:00 am – midnight ET.
